Concept of blockchain in crypto

Cryptocurrencies are digital or virtual tokens that use cryptography to secure their transactions and to control the creation of new units. Cryptocurrencies are decentralized, meaning they are not subject to government or financial institution control.

The first cryptocurrency, Bitcoin, was created in 2009. Since then, hundreds of different cryptocurrencies have been created. These are often called altcoins, as a contraction of “bitcoin alternative.”

Blockchain is the underlying technology of cryptocurrencies. A blockchain is a digital ledger of all cryptocurrency transactions. It is constantly growing as “completed” blocks are added to it with a new set of recordings. Each block contains a cryptographic hash of the previous block, a timestamp, and transaction data. Bitcoin nodes use the block chain to differentiate legitimate Bitcoin transactions from attempts to re-spend coins that have already been spent elsewhere.

How does blockchain in crypto work?

Blockchain in crypto works by creating a digital ledger of all the transactions that have taken place. This ledger is then distributed to all the computers in the network, and each computer verifies the transactions. Once all the computers have verified the transactions, the blockchain is complete.

The benefits of blockchain in crypto are that it is secure, transparent, and cannot be tampered with. This makes it an ideal way to store and transfer value.

Applications of blockchain in crypto

Cryptocurrencies have been on the rise in recent years, with Bitcoin becoming increasingly mainstream. Along with this, there has been a rise in interest in blockchain, the technology that underpins Bitcoin. While blockchain is most commonly associated with Bitcoin, there are many other potential applications for the technology. Here are some of the ways that blockchain could be used in the future of crypto:

1. Decentralized exchanges: Cryptocurrencies are currently traded on centralized exchanges, which are vulnerable to hacks and theft. A decentralized exchange would allow users to trade directly with each other, without the need for a central authority. This would make it much harder for hackers to steal funds, as there would be no central point of attack.

2. ICOs: Initial coin offerings (ICOs) are a popular way for blockchain startups to raise funds. However, there have been some concerns about the lack of regulation around ICOs. A decentralized exchange could help to solve this problem by allowing startups to list their ICOs in a transparent and secure way.

3. Wallets: Cryptocurrency wallets are currently centralized, which means that they are vulnerable to hacks. A decentralized wallet would give users much more control over their funds, as they would not be stored in a central location.

4. Voting: Blockchain technology could be used to create a decentralized voting system. This would allow users to vote on proposals in a secure and transparent way.

5. Data storage: Data storage is another area where blockchain could be used. A decentralized data storage system would be much more secure than a centralized one, as it would be much harder for hackers to gain access to the data.

6. Identity management: Blockchain could be used to create a decentralized identity management system. This would give users control over their own data, and would make it much harder for identity theft to occur.

7. Supply chain management: Blockchain could be used to track items as they move through the supply chain. This would allow businesses to ensure that their products are being made in a sustainable way, and would also help to prevent counterfeiting.

8. Copyright protection: Blockchain could be used to create a decentralized copyright protection system. This would allow creators to register their work in a secure and transparent way, and would make it much harder for piracy to occur.

9. Prediction markets: Prediction markets are a way of betting on the outcome of events. Blockchain could be used to create decentralized prediction markets, which would be much more accurate than traditional markets.

10. Social media: Social media platforms are currently centralized, which means that they are vulnerable to censorship and manipulation. A decentralized social media platform would allow users to interact with each other in a secure and transparent way.
